1、The technical characteristic and application of optical couplerThe optical coupler (OC) also calls the photoelectricity disconnector or the photoelectricity coupler.It transmits the electrical signal component taking the light as the medium.usually the illuminator (infrared light emitter diode LED)
2、and optical receiver (photosensitive transistor) are sealed in the identical shell. When the importation added the electrical signal, the illuminator sends out the light, after accepted the light ,the light rcceiver producing the photoelectric current, flowing out from the exportation, thus realized
3、 the “electricity - light - electricity” transformation. The optical coupler,taking the light as medium and coupling importation signal to exportation, because of the slightly volume, the long life, the non-contact, the antijamming ability, between the exportation and the importation insulating, uni
4、directional transmission signal and so on, obtains the widespread application on the digital circuit. For several years, the new type optical coupler emerged unceasingly, have satisfied each kind of light controlingt.Its application scope expanded the measuring instruments, precision instrument, ind
5、ustrial used electronic instrumentation, computer and external instrumentation, telegraph, semaphore and path intelligence system, electrical power equipment and so on. The optical coupler has used in the system of electrical isolation, like computer, power source supply, communication and controlle
6、r.The example, the optical coupler is using in the telecommunication equipment, the programmable controller, the cocurrent-Direct-current switch, exchange-Direct-current switch and battery charger and so on. The optical coupler is the heart of an optical communication network core,Using in the elect
7、rical isolation of input signal and the corresponding output signal.Playing the roles in the different isolation electric circuits, the needing voltages are very great different.The optical coupler has provided a superiority, that is the electricity isolates between two electric circuits,thus reduce
8、d the connection questions.The electrical isolation occurrence is because of the signal transmission through the LED illumination, and by the light responded the transistor receives. When change the size of electric current driving the light emitter diode, the light size also along with it changing
9、proportion, thus the resistor resistance is also changed.In addition,the photoelectricity coupler also may use in controlling the alternating-current circuit power, for example heater circuit。This kind of optical coupler is the silicon-controlled rectifier outputing optical coupler, as the chart sho
10、ws. Its may used in the low voltage electronic circuit controlling high voltage alternating-current circuit opening.Its principle of working is: Controlling the photosensitive bidirectional switch breakover in the exportation using infrared light in the importation, then triggering the bidirectional
11、 silicon-controlled rectifier breakover outside, achieved the goal of controlling the 220V alternating-current circuit. This driver has extremely good input-output insulating property,and may constitutes the solid state relay controlling circuit, and its output controlling power decided by bidirecti
12、onal silicon-controlled rectifier.Usual photoelectricity coupler because of its non-linearity, is only restricted in the analogous circuit application of the high frequency small signal isolation transmission.The ordinary optical coupler can only transmit the the digital signal(switch), not suitable
13、 for transmitting simulation signal. In recent years,the linear optical coupler published could transmit the continuously variety simulation voltage or the simulation electric current signal, caused its application domain becoming widely greatly. It is widely used in the level transforming, the sign
14、al isolation, the interstage isolation, the switching circuit, the remote signal transmission, the pulse enlarges, solid state relay (SSR), the instrument measuring appliance, the communication facility and in the microcomputer connection.The input impedance of optical coupler is smaller than genera
15、l noise source s impedance l, therefore, the disturbing voltage on importation is small .It can only provide small electric current , not easy to cause the semiconductor diode illumination; Because the photoelectricity coupler outer covering is sealed, it is not affected by exterior light。The photoe
16、lectricity couplers isolation resistor is very big (approximately 1012) and the isolation electric capacity is very small (approximately several pF) ,therefore, it can reject the electromagnetic interference of circuit coupling. When the linear photoelectricity couplers importation added the control
17、 voltage, there is a proportion voltage in the exportation using to control the further level electric circuit.The linear photoelectricity coupler is composed by the light emitter diode and the photosensitive triode,.when the light emitter diode shines, the photosensitive triode connects.The photoel
18、ectricity coupler is the electric current actuation, which needs enough big electric current to be able to cause the light emitter diode breakover. If the input signal is too small, the light emitter diode will not be able the breakover, and the output signal to distort.The optical coupler technical
